In recent years, Toyota has lobbied hard against stricter pollution regulations that favored electric vehicles over the auto giant’s hybrid vehicles, but experts question their reasoning. Gil Tal, director of the Electric Vehicle Research Center at the University of California, Davis’s Institute of Transportation Studies, said that while hybrids were “very efficient on lowering emissions a little bit, they’re not very effective in bringing us to zero emissions in the long run.”
